The SEM image and elemental distribution of the incompletely reacted residue(Figs.8 (a)and 8(b)) indicate thepresence of an obvious core–shell structure.Because of the difficult dissolution of zinc ferrite,the core,with high Fe and Zn contents,corresponded to the unreacted area in the center of the raw material particles.The surface of the shell was covered by SiO2.In contrast,the SEM image and elemental distribution of the completely reacted residue(Figs.8 (c)and 8(d)) indicate that the structure was uniform and composed mainly of SiO2,with white dots in the edges which were identified as Pb and O.In addition,the elements analysis results of the spots labeled in Figs.8(a)and8(c)tested by EDS were listed in Tables 3 and 4,respectively.
